    badr 6 C-band

    Hello,

    I am living in Holland....i wonder if i can receive badr 6 the C-band ...
    badr 6 Ku-band is not available in europe...
    so how can i receive badr 6 C-band here with my digitale receiver...
    or do i need an analogue receiver for the C-band...
    and what is the dish size required and the LNB sort....

    friendely greetings....

    Hello!
    and welcome on board!
    badr 6 is just lunched,in the first july week,i dont here any report that is curencly active with porgrams!
    but i think it will start very soon!

    for 26 east cband positions i recomended minimum of 1,50 m full size dish here,with my 1,86 m dish i can nearly reveive everything!
    the 30,5 e at the moment is much weaker,and needs ofert 2 m dish,but lets wait,until the new satelite is in service,then we know more!
    what dish dou you have at the moment?

    To receive any C band transmissions you will need a C band lnb and a C band stb, but until transmissions start nobody knows...... Badr 6 is currently at the 20 East slot

    BADR6 C BAND projected footprint = http://www.arabsat.com/ArabSat/Engli...BADR6Cband.htm

    24 c Band TPs and there are 4 higher power TPs at + 3dBW = 33-36dBW (36-39dBW by 2nd diag) in UK if I have read it right..... 1.5m in central UK?

    20 Ku Tps and the projected BADR6 Ku band footprint is shown (left menu) and looks like 7w or MBC's footprints on 26e so it's difficult to project what BADR6 will be like here, but most capacity that has already been contracted is for Africa /ME etc... (see NEWS & PRESS links) at top.
    Mostly new HD TV / data & telephony
